What is CBD, and Why is Everyone Talking About It?

Before we dive into the specifics of CBD gummies and CBD oil, let’s clarify what CBD is and why it's become a hot topic in the wellness world. CBD, or cannabidiol, is a non-intoxicating compound found in the cannabis plant. Unlike THC, the psychoactive component, CBD doesn’t produce a "high." Instead, it interacts with the body's endocannabinoid system (ECS), which plays a crucial role in regulating various functions, including mood, sleep, pain, and immune response. This interaction is why many people turn to CBD for potential benefits in these areas.

Understanding CBD Oil: Versatility and Potency

CBD oil is typically extracted from the hemp plant and diluted with a carrier oil, such as MCT oil, hemp seed oil, or olive oil. It's usually administered sublingually (under the tongue) using a dropper.

Benefits of CBD Oil:

  • Faster Absorption: Sublingual administration allows CBD to be absorbed directly into the bloodstream, bypassing the digestive system. This leads to faster onset of effects compared to edibles like gummies.
  • Precise Dosing: The dropper allows for precise dosage control, which is particularly helpful for those who need specific amounts of CBD to achieve their desired effects.
  • Versatility: CBD oil can be added to food, drinks, or even applied topically (though this is less common).
  • Potency Options: Available in various concentrations, catering to both beginners and experienced users seeking higher dosages.

Drawbacks of CBD Oil:

  • Taste: Some people find the taste of CBD oil earthy or bitter, which can be unpleasant.
  • Administration: Requires holding the oil under the tongue for about 30-60 seconds, which some may find inconvenient.
  • Portability: While easy enough to carry, bottles can leak, especially when traveling.

Delving into CBD Gummies: Convenience and Enjoyment

CBD gummies are chewable candies infused with CBD. They are pre-dosed, making them a convenient and discreet way to consume CBD. They often come in various flavors, shapes, and strengths.

Benefits of CBD Gummies:

  • Convenience: Pre-dosed and easy to carry, making them ideal for on-the-go use.
  • Discreetness: Resemble regular candies, allowing for discreet consumption in public.
  • Taste: Flavored to mask the taste of CBD, making them more palatable for some.
  • Ease of Use: No measuring or droppers needed, simplifying the consumption process.

Drawbacks of CBD Gummies:

  • Slower Absorption: Must be digested, resulting in a slower onset of effects compared to CBD oil.
  • Lower Bioavailability: Some of the CBD is lost during digestion, meaning you may need a higher dose to achieve the same effects as with oil.
  • Sugar Content: Many gummies contain sugar, which may not be suitable for those with dietary restrictions or health concerns.
  • Inconsistent Dosage: While pre-dosed, the actual CBD content can sometimes vary slightly between gummies from the same batch.

Dosage Considerations

Regardless of whether you choose CBD gummies or CBD oil, it’s essential to start with a low dose and gradually increase it until you find the optimal amount for your needs. Dosage can vary significantly from person to person, so it's best to experiment carefully and consult with a healthcare professional, especially if you are taking other medications.

Important Considerations: Quality and Safety

Regardless of the form you choose, quality is paramount. Always purchase CBD products from reputable brands that provide third-party lab testing to verify the CBD content and ensure the absence of contaminants like pesticides, heavy metals, and residual solvents. Look for a Certificate of Analysis (COA) readily available on the company's website or upon request.

Also, be aware that the CBD industry is still relatively new and unregulated, so do your research and choose products carefully. Talk to your doctor before starting CBD, especially if you have underlying health conditions or are taking other medications, as CBD can potentially interact with some drugs.

Beyond Gummies and Oil: Exploring Other CBD Forms

While CBD gummies and CBD oil are two of the most popular options, they are not the only ones. Other forms include:

  • CBD Capsules: Similar to gummies in terms of convenience and pre-dosed nature but without the added sugar.
  • CBD Topicals: Creams, lotions, and balms applied directly to the skin for localized relief.
  • CBD Vape Products: Inhaled for fast absorption but come with potential respiratory health concerns. (Note: use of vape product have more risk than any other kind of intake)
